Especially for purposes of importing existing tstory documents into Scrivener, it would be useful to b able to set one default font for the entire draft. Possibly this could be done through a right-click option on Draft or a Group.

Post by KB on Oct 29, 2005 8:59:23 GMT
This option already exists under Format > Convert Draft to Default Style. Be aware that it doesn't preserve italics or bold, though, and that it is undoable (there is a warning for that).
